AI 코딩 혁명 완벽 가이드: 개발자 없이 연봉 1억 서비스 만들기 (2025 결정판)

7 min read0 viewsBy Colemearchy
AI코딩CursorVibe Coding프롬프트 엔지니어링인공지능LLMGPT노코드로우코드

AI 코딩 혁명 완벽 가이드: 개발자 없이 연봉 1억 서비스 만들기 (2025 결정판)

🔥 지금 AI 코딩을 배워야 하는 이유: 2025년, 기회가 폭발한다!

2024년, 우리는 AI 코딩 혁명의 초입에 서 있습니다. 더 이상 코딩은 '전문 개발자'만의 영역이 아닙니다. 인공지능이 코딩을 돕고, 심지어 대신하는 시대가 왔습니다. 이 변화를 감지하고 AI 코딩을 배우는 사람만이 2025년, 엄청난 기회를 잡을 수 있습니다.

단언컨대, AI 코딩은 제2의 인터넷 혁명입니다. 웹사이트 하나 만들려면 수백만 원이 들었던 과거와 달리, 지금은 누구나 쉽게 블로그를 만들 수 있습니다. 마찬가지로, 과거에는 상상도 못 했던 '나만의 AI 서비스'를 만들 기회가 눈앞에 왔습니다.

이 글은 AI 코딩에 대한 모든 것을 담았습니다. 기초 개념부터 실전 튜토리얼, 고급 활용 전략까지, 여러분을 'AI 코딩 전문가'로 만들어 줄 것입니다. 자, 혁명의 파도에 몸을 싣고, 함께 미래를 만들어 갑시다!

1️⃣ AI 코딩, 도대체 뭘까요? (차가운 고객을 위한 AI 코딩 기초)

1. AI 코딩이란 무엇일까요?

AI 코딩은 인공지능을 활용하여 소프트웨어를 개발하는 방식입니다. 기존 코딩 방식은 개발자가 직접 모든 코드를 작성해야 했지만, AI 코딩은 AI가 코드 생성, 오류 수정, 테스트 등 개발 과정을 돕습니다. 덕분에 비개발자도 쉽게 앱, 웹사이트, 자동화 시스템 등을 만들 수 있습니다.

2. AI 코딩, 왜 이렇게 핫할까요? (장점 파헤치기)

  • 개발 속도 초고속: AI가 코드를 자동 생성하므로 개발 시간을 획기적으로 단축합니다. 아이디어만 있다면, 며칠 만에 프로토타입을 만들 수 있습니다.
  • 비용 절감 효과: 개발자 없이도 AI 코딩 도구를 활용하여 서비스를 만들 수 있습니다. 인건비 부담 없이 창업에 도전할 수 있습니다.
  • 생산성 극대화: AI가 반복적인 작업을 대신하므로, 개발자는 창의적인 작업에 집중할 수 있습니다. 생산성이 기하급수적으로 증가합니다.
  • 진입 장벽 대폭 낮춤: 코딩 지식이 없어도 AI의 도움을 받아 개발할 수 있습니다. 누구나 아이디어를 현실로 만들 수 있습니다.

3. AI 코딩, 어떤 기술이 숨어 있을까요? (핵심 기술 엿보기)

  • LLM (Large Language Model): 방대한 텍스트 데이터를 학습한 AI 모델입니다. 자연어 이해 능력이 뛰어나, 사용자의 요구사항을 코드로 변환합니다. (예: GPT, Claude, Gemini)
  • 프롬프트 엔지니어링: LLM에게 원하는 결과를 얻기 위해 효과적인 '프롬프트'를 작성하는 기술입니다. AI 코딩의 핵심 스킬입니다.
  • 노코드/로우코드: 코딩 없이 (또는 최소한의 코딩으로) 서비스를 만들 수 있는 개발 방식입니다. AI 코딩과 결합하여 시너지 효과를 냅니다.

4. AI 코딩, 어디에 써먹을 수 있을까요? (활용 분야 무궁무진)

  • 웹/앱 개발: AI 기반 웹사이트, 모바일 앱을 쉽게 만들 수 있습니다.
  • 업무 자동화: 반복적인 업무를 자동화하는 시스템을 구축할 수 있습니다.
  • 콘텐츠 제작: AI가 블로그 글, 마케팅 문구 등을 자동으로 생성합니다.
  • 데이터 분석: AI가 데이터를 분석하고 유용한 정보를 추출합니다.

5. AI 코딩, 지금 시작해도 괜찮을까요? (미래 전망)

네, 지금이 바로 시작할 때입니다! AI 코딩 기술은 계속 발전하고 있으며, 앞으로 더 많은 분야에서 활용될 것입니다. 지금 AI 코딩을 배우면, 미래 시대의 핵심 인재로 거듭날 수 있습니다. 제가 왜 '개발 공부'를 그만두라고 했을까요?에서 더 자세한 이야기를 확인하세요.

👉 더 알아보기

2️⃣ AI 코딩 도구, 뭘 써야 할까요? (따뜻한 고객을 위한 도구 비교)

AI 코딩 도구는 많지만, 대표적인 도구는 다음과 같습니다. 각 도구의 특징을 비교하고, 자신에게 맞는 도구를 선택하세요.

1. Cursor: AI 코딩에 최적화된 IDE

Cursor는 AI 코딩에 특화된 통합 개발 환경(IDE)입니다. ChatGPT와 유사한 인터페이스를 제공하며, 코드 자동 완성, 오류 수정, 코드 설명 등 다양한 AI 기능을 제공합니다. 특히, 코드 검색 및 탐색 기능이 강력하여, 대규모 프로젝트에 적합합니다.

  • 장점: 강력한 AI 기능, 코드 검색/탐색 용이, 다양한 언어 지원
  • 단점: 유료 플랜 필요 (무료 플랜 제한적), 초기 설정 다소 복잡

2. ChatGPT: 만능 AI 비서, 코딩도 잘해요

ChatGPT는 OpenAI에서 개발한 대화형 AI 모델입니다. 코딩뿐만 아니라 글쓰기, 번역, 요약 등 다양한 작업을 수행할 수 있습니다. 코딩 경험이 없는 사람도 쉽게 사용할 수 있으며, 간단한 코드 생성 및 오류 수정에 유용합니다.

  • 장점: 사용하기 쉬움, 다양한 작업 가능, 풍부한 자료
  • 단점: 복잡한 코드 생성에는 한계, 코드 품질 보장 어려움

3. Replit: 온라인 코딩 환경, 협업도 OK!

Replit은 웹 브라우저에서 코딩할 수 있는 온라인 IDE입니다. AI 코딩 기능 (Ghostwriter)을 제공하며, 실시간 협업 기능을 지원합니다. 간단한 프로젝트나 교육용으로 적합합니다.

  • 장점: 설치 불필요, 실시간 협업, 사용하기 쉬움
  • 단점: AI 기능 제한적, 인터넷 연결 필수

4. Lovable: 비개발자를 위한 AI 코딩 플랫폼

Lovable은 코딩 지식이 없는 사람도 AI 기반 앱을 만들 수 있는 플랫폼입니다. 드래그 앤 드롭 방식으로 UI를 디자인하고, AI가 코드를 자동으로 생성합니다. 아이디어를 빠르게 프로토타입으로 만들 수 있습니다.

  • 장점: 코딩 지식 불필요, 빠른 프로토타입 제작, 쉬운 UI 디자인
  • 단점: 기능 제한적, 복잡한 앱 개발에는 한계

👉 나에게 맞는 도구는?

  • AI 코딩 초보: ChatGPT 또는 Lovable
  • AI 코딩 경험: Cursor 또는 Replit
  • 협업: Replit
  • 복잡한 프로젝트: Cursor

📝 참고: The No-Code Era is Over. Welcome to the Age of Vibe Coding.에서 바이브 코딩에 대한 더 자세한 정보를 얻을 수 있습니다.

👉 더 알아보기

3️⃣ Cursor AI 실전 가이드: AI 코딩, 이렇게 하는 겁니다! (뜨거운 고객을 위한 튜토리얼)

Cursor AI를 사용하여 실제로 코딩하는 방법을 알아봅시다. 이 튜토리얼에서는 간단한 웹 페이지를 만드는 과정을 안내합니다.

1. Cursor 설치 및 설정

Cursor 웹사이트 (https://cursor.sh/)에서 Cursor를 다운로드하여 설치합니다. 설치 후, OpenAI API 키를 설정해야 합니다. API 키는 OpenAI 웹사이트에서 발급받을 수 있습니다.

2. 새 프로젝트 생성

Cursor를 실행하고, 'Create New Project'를 클릭합니다. 프로젝트 이름과 위치를 설정하고, 사용할 프로그래밍 언어 (예: HTML, CSS, JavaScript)를 선택합니다.

3. AI에게 코드 생성 요청

에디터 창에 다음과 같이 프롬프트를 입력합니다.

// 간단한 웹 페이지를 만들어줘. 제목은 'AI 코딩 가이드'이고, 내용은 'AI 코딩으로 미래를 만들자!'로 해줘.

Cursor는 AI 기능을 사용하여 자동으로 HTML 코드를 생성합니다. 생성된 코드를 확인하고, 필요한 경우 수정합니다.

4. CSS 스타일 적용

프롬프트를 사용하여 CSS 스타일을 적용할 수 있습니다.

// 제목을 중앙 정렬하고, 글자 크기를 30px로 키워줘.

Cursor는 자동으로 CSS 코드를 생성하고, 웹 페이지에 스타일을 적용합니다.

5. JavaScript 기능 추가

프롬프트를 사용하여 JavaScript 기능을 추가할 수 있습니다.

// 버튼을 클릭하면 알림창이 뜨도록 해줘. 알림창 내용은 'AI 코딩 만세!'로 해줘.

Cursor는 자동으로 JavaScript 코드를 생성하고, 웹 페이지에 기능을 추가합니다.

6. 코드 실행 및 테스트

Cursor 에디터에서 코드를 실행하고, 웹 페이지가 제대로 작동하는지 확인합니다. 오류가 발생하면, AI 기능을 사용하여 오류를 수정합니다.

💡 꿀팁: AI 조수 '커서(Cursor)', 연봉 1억짜리로 만드는 전문가 세팅법 (2편)에서 Cursor 활용 팁을 더 얻을 수 있습니다.

👉 더 알아보기

4️⃣ AI 코딩, 더 깊이 파고들기 (고급 활용 전략)

AI 코딩 기술을 더욱 발전시키기 위한 고급 활용 전략을 소개합니다.

1. 프롬프트 엔지니어링 마스터하기

프롬프트 엔지니어링은 AI 코딩의 핵심 스킬입니다. LLM에게 명확하고 구체적인 프롬프트를 제공하여 원하는 결과를 얻어야 합니다. 다양한 프롬프트 작성 기법을 익히고, 자신만의 프롬프트 스타일을 개발하세요.

  • 구체적인 지시: 원하는 결과를 최대한 구체적으로 설명합니다.
  • 예시 제공: 원하는 결과와 유사한 예시를 제공합니다.
  • 역할 부여: AI에게 특정 역할을 부여하여 답변의 품질을 높입니다.

2. 바이브 코딩으로 생산성 극대화

바이브 코딩은 AI와 협력하여 코딩하는 방식입니다. AI가 코드를 생성하면, 개발자는 코드의 품질을 검토하고 수정합니다. 이 과정을 반복하면서 생산성을 극대화할 수 있습니다. Journey from chronic pain to recovery. Include specific exer에서 팁을 얻으세요.

3. AI 코딩 커뮤니티 활용

AI 코딩 커뮤니티에 참여하여 다른 개발자들과 정보를 공유하고, 협력 프로젝트를 진행하세요. 커뮤니티는 AI 코딩 기술을 발전시키는 데 큰 도움이 됩니다.

4. 오픈 소스 프로젝트 기여

오픈 소스 AI 코딩 프로젝트에 기여하여 자신의 실력을 향상시키고, 다른 개발자들과 함께 기술을 발전시키세요.

👉 더 알아보기

🎉 AI 코딩, 미래를 여는 열쇠!

AI 코딩은 더 이상 먼 미래의 이야기가 아닙니다. 지금 바로 AI 코딩을 시작하여 자신의 아이디어를 현실로 만들고, 미래 시대의 주역이 되세요!

🚀 다음 단계:

  1. Cursor AI 설치: 지금 바로 Cursor AI를 설치하고, AI 코딩을 경험해보세요.
  2. AI 코딩 커뮤니티 참여: AI 코딩 커뮤니티에 참여하여 다른 개발자들과 정보를 공유하세요.
  3. 나만의 AI 서비스 개발: AI 코딩 기술을 활용하여 나만의 AI 서비스를 개발해보세요.

📢 함께 미래를 만들어갈 동료를 찾습니다!

  • 댓글: 이 글에 대한 의견이나 질문을 댓글로 남겨주세요.
  • 뉴스레터: AI 코딩 관련 최신 정보를 뉴스레터로 받아보세요.
  • 다음 글: 다음 글에서는 AI 코딩을 활용한 수익 창출 방법에 대해 알아보겠습니다.
AI 코딩 혁명 완벽 가이드: 개발자 없이 연봉 1억 서비스 만들기 (2025 결정판)